**Vendor note: Inkmill markdown pipeline**

Rendering for Parchway docs is outsourced to Inkmill under an annual contract, renewing each March. They handle sanitization and PDF export; we own the upload queue. SLA: 4-hour response on rendering failures. Escalate only after two failed retries. Their support desk is reachable at the address below.

billing contact of hahaf-baguf = zorael.tammir.jorius@sivrelhq.internal

## Configuration

Echohall, our museum audio-guide app, reads all runtime settings from a single env file loaded at startup. Reviewers should check that the tour-pack base path and the narration bitrate are both set; defaults exist but are wrong for gallery hardware. Offline mode is toggled per-exhibit in the admin panel, not here. The only sensitive entry is the streaming credential, which appears on its own line immediately after this sentence.

secret setting of yajog-taguf: ARCHIVE_KEY3=051

## Releases

RemindRx sends appointment reminders for Calder Clinic partners nightly at 02:00. Releases are cut from main, tagged, and pushed to the Ostlin registry. On-call: verify the dry-run report before promoting — a bad template means thousands of wrong reminders. Rollback is one tag back; reminder state is idempotent. Builds must pass the signature gate before the scheduler accepts them. The gate verifies against the current release signing key.

signing key of bagap-yawep = bky13_TbfT6ZMUoGJo2